# Best Practices for Protecting Digital Assets

Implementing best practices is crucial for maintaining a strong cybersecurity posture. The Postgraduate Certificate in Cybersecurity Essentials emphasizes the importance of adhering to industry standards and best practices to protect digital assets.

1. Regular Updates and Patching: Keeping systems and software up to date is one of the simplest yet most effective ways to protect against cyber threats. The program teaches the importance of regular updates and patch management to close vulnerabilities.

2. Multi-Factor Authentication (MFA): MFA adds an extra layer of security by requiring multiple forms of verification. The course covers the implementation and management of MFA systems to enhance security.

3. Data Encryption: Encrypting sensitive data ensures that even if it is intercepted, it remains unreadable. The program provides in-depth training on encryption techniques and best practices for data protection.

4. Employee Training and Awareness: Human error is often the weakest link in cybersecurity. The course emphasizes the importance of ongoing employee training and awareness programs to educate staff on cyber threats and best practices.

# Career Opportunities in Cybersecurity

The demand for cybersecurity professionals is at an all-time high, and the Postgraduate Certificate in Cybersecurity Essentials opens up a world of career opportunities. Graduates are well-prepared to take on roles that are in high demand across various industries.

1. Cybersecurity Analyst: As a cybersecurity analyst, you will be responsible for monitoring security systems, identifying threats, and responding to incidents. This role requires a deep understanding of various cyber threats and the ability to implement effective security measures.

2. Security Architect: Security architects design and implement secure network and computer systems. They work closely with IT teams to ensure that security is integrated into all aspects of the organization's infrastructure.

3. Incident Response Specialist: Incident response specialists are the first line of defense against cyber attacks. They are responsible for investigating and responding to security breaches, ensuring minimal disruption to business operations.
